Runway End Light Market size was valued at USD 0.4 Billion in 2022 and is projected to reach USD 0.7 Billion by 2030, growing at a CAGR of 7.5% from 2024 to 2030. The increasing demand for advanced lighting solutions in the aviation sector and the focus on airport modernization contribute significantly to this growth. With the growing need for ensuring safety and visibility at airports, runway end lights are becoming an integral part of airfield infrastructure worldwide.
The market expansion is also driven by the rise in air traffic and government investments in enhancing airport infrastructure. The market's growth prospects are further fueled by technological advancements in LED and solar-powered runway end lights, which offer higher energy efficiency and lower maintenance costs. Additionally, the rising focus on sustainable and eco-friendly lighting solutions in the aviation industry is expected to support the market's growth trajectory over the forecast period.

The Runway End Light Market, particularly segmented by application, plays a vital role in ensuring the safety and efficiency of airport operations. Runway end lights are crucial in guiding aircraft during takeoff and landing operations, marking the end of the runway and providing essential visibility under low-light or hazardous conditions. This market is driven by the increasing demand for modernized aviation infrastructure, technological advancements in lighting systems, and growing air traffic worldwide. The two major applications in this market include "Civilian and Commercial Airports" and "Military Airports," each presenting unique characteristics and requirements for runway end lighting solutions.
Civilian and commercial airports represent a significant portion of the Runway End Light market. These airports are often busy hubs of air travel, with high passenger traffic and complex operational needs. Runway end lights in these airports are designed for efficiency, longevity, and to comply with international aviation standards such as those set by the International Civil Aviation Organization (ICAO). Civilian airports require high-visibility lighting systems, especially at larger hubs with multiple runways, to manage both daytime and nighttime operations effectively. As air traffic volume increases globally, the demand for advanced runway lighting solutions that can support these high-traffic airports has grown. This includes the integration of LED lighting, which offers energy efficiency, reduced maintenance costs, and enhanced durability in the face of environmental wear and tear.
Furthermore, the increasing focus on improving airport safety standards contributes to the growth of runway end light installations in civilian and commercial airports. Airports are investing heavily in infrastructure upgrades, with emphasis on minimizing the risks associated with runway incursions and aircraft navigation errors. The advancements in automation, remote monitoring, and intelligent lighting systems have transformed the way runway end lights are managed, enabling airport operators to enhance operational efficiency while reducing human error. This growing trend of automation, alongside the need for scalable and adaptable lighting solutions, positions the market for continued expansion, with a clear focus on meeting both functional and regulatory requirements across airports globally.
Military airports, though more specialized than civilian counterparts, also contribute to the runway end light market. These facilities often operate under highly demanding conditions, where precision, reliability, and operational security are paramount. Military airports typically require runway lighting solutions that are not only compliant with standard aviation lighting regulations but also capable of withstanding extreme environmental conditions such as high winds, low temperatures, and dust storms. The lights used in military airports must meet strict specifications to support a variety of military aircraft operations, including fighter jets, cargo planes, and helicopters, which may operate on runways under different weather and visibility conditions. Additionally, military runways might be located in more remote or challenging environments, making durability and energy efficiency key factors for lighting systems deployed in these areas.
The growing strategic importance of defense infrastructure and the increasing investment in military airbases globally are driving the demand for specialized runway end lighting systems. Military applications often require enhanced technological capabilities, such as high-intensity lighting that can withstand extreme shocks or operate in specific operational modes during night or inclement weather conditions. As military forces modernize their equipment and airfields, runway end lights are also being upgraded to incorporate more robust technologies, including integration with radar systems, infrared lighting for stealth operations, and adaptive lighting systems that can be manually controlled or adjusted remotely. The ongoing development of advanced lighting solutions to meet these unique operational requirements creates significant opportunities for growth within the military airport subsegment of the market.
The runway end light market is experiencing several key trends and opportunities that are shaping its future development. One of the primary trends is the growing demand for energy-efficient lighting solutions, particularly LED-based systems. LED lights offer several advantages over traditional incandescent and halogen lighting, including lower energy consumption, longer service life, and reduced maintenance costs. As environmental sustainability becomes a more significant concern for both civil and military aviation sectors, the adoption of LED lighting systems is increasing due to their ability to reduce operational costs and carbon footprints. Airports worldwide are investing in retrofitting their existing runway lighting infrastructure to LED systems, creating substantial opportunities for market players involved in manufacturing and providing these products.
Another prominent trend is the integration of smart technology in runway lighting systems. Automation, remote monitoring, and intelligent systems are increasingly being used to enhance operational efficiency and reduce the risks of human error. Runway end lights can now be equipped with sensors that monitor aircraft movements and adjust lighting based on visibility, weather conditions, or time of day. These systems allow airport operators to optimize runway lighting configurations, reduce energy consumption, and ensure safety. Moreover, the growing use of artificial intelligence (AI) in aviation is expected to drive the development of adaptive lighting systems that can respond dynamically to changing operational conditions, offering greater flexibility and precision in managing runway end lights.
The expansion of air travel in emerging markets presents another significant opportunity in the runway end light market. As airports in regions such as Asia-Pacific, the Middle East, and Africa continue to expand to accommodate growing passenger traffic, there is an increasing need for modern runway infrastructure, including high-quality runway end lights. This trend is further supported by government investments in infrastructure development, which is expected to stimulate demand for advanced runway lighting solutions. Additionally, the increasing prevalence of public-private partnerships (PPPs) in the aviation industry is driving investments in airport modernization, presenting opportunities for market participants to collaborate with government and private stakeholders on large-scale runway lighting projects.
